X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=include%2Flinux%2Fmount.h;h=ba20050df8d95e4272a18a5069f0869ac5ea77df;hb=6a77f38946aaee1cd85eeec6cf4229b204c15071;hp=42e2c9460088e46f560ee17331340e5b60d66f1d;hpb=87fc8d1bb10cd459024a742c6a10961fefcef18f;p=linux-2.6.git diff --git a/include/linux/mount.h b/include/linux/mount.h index 42e2c9460..ba20050df 100644 --- a/include/linux/mount.h +++ b/include/linux/mount.h @@ -13,10 +13,13 @@ #ifdef __KERNEL__ #include +#include +#include #define MNT_NOSUID 1 #define MNT_NODEV 2 #define MNT_NOEXEC 4 +#define MNT_XID 256 struct vfsmount { @@ -34,6 +37,7 @@ struct vfsmount struct list_head mnt_list; struct list_head mnt_fslink; /* link in fs-specific expiry list */ struct namespace *mnt_namespace; /* containing namespace */ + xid_t mnt_xid; /* xid tagging used for vfsmount */ }; static inline struct vfsmount *mntget(struct vfsmount *mnt)